> In the minimal pixman API stub that is used when the real pixman
> dependency is missing a NULL dereference happens when
> virtio-gpu-rutabaga allocates a pixman image with bits = NULL and
> rowstride_bytes = zero. A buffer of rowstride_bytes * height is
> allocated which is NULL. However, in that scenario pixman calculates a
> new stride value based on given width, height and format size.
>
> This commit adds a helper function that performs the same logic as
> pixman.
>

> diff --git a/include/ui/pixman-minimal.h b/include/ui/pixman-minimal.h
> index efcf570c9e..6dd7de1c7e 100644
> --- a/include/ui/pixman-minimal.h
> +++ b/include/ui/pixman-minimal.h
> @@ -113,6 +113,45 @@ typedef struct pixman_color {
>      uint16_t    alpha;
>  } pixman_color_t;
>
> +static inline uint32_t *create_bits(pixman_format_code_t format,
> +                                    int width,
> +                                    int height,
> +                                    int *rowstride_bytes)
> +{
> +    int stride = 0;
> +    size_t buf_size = 0;
> +    int bpp = PIXMAN_FORMAT_BPP(format);
> +
> +    /*
> +     * Calculate the following while checking for overflow truncation:
> +     * stride = ((width * bpp + 0x1f) >> 5) * sizeof(uint32_t);
> +     */
> +
> +    if (unlikely(__builtin_mul_overflow(width, bpp, &stride))) {
> +        return NULL;
> +    }
> +
> +    if (unlikely(__builtin_add_overflow(stride, 0x1f, &stride))) {
> +        return NULL;
> +    }
> +
> +    stride >>= 5;
> +
> +    stride *= sizeof(uint32_t);
> +
> +    if (unlikely(__builtin_mul_overflow((size_t) height,
> +                                        (size_t) stride,
> +                                        &buf_size))) {
> +        return NULL;
> +    }
> +
> +    if (rowstride_bytes) {
> +        *rowstride_bytes = stride;
> +    }
> +
> +    return g_malloc0(buf_size);
> +}
> +
>  static inline pixman_image_t *pixman_image_create_bits(pixman_format_code_t format,
>                                                         int width,
>                                                         int height,
> @@ -123,13 +162,18 @@ static inline pixman_image_t *pixman_image_create_bits(pixman_format_code_t form
>
>      i->width = width;
>      i->height = height;
> -    i->stride = rowstride_bytes ?: width * DIV_ROUND_UP(PIXMAN_FORMAT_BPP(format), 8);
>      i->format = format;
>      if (bits) {
>          i->data = bits;
>      } else {
> -        i->free_me = i->data = g_malloc0(rowstride_bytes * height);
> +        i->free_me = i->data =
> +            create_bits(format, width, height, &rowstride_bytes);
> +        if (width && height) {
> +            assert(i->data);
> +        }
>      }
> +    i->stride = rowstride_bytes ? rowstride_bytes :
> +                            width * DIV_ROUND_UP(PIXMAN_FORMAT_BPP(format), 8);
>      i->ref_count = 1;
>
>      return i;
>
